Official documents necessary to initiate and process the dissolution of marriage within the jurisdiction of San Diego County, California, are fundamental to the legal procedure. These documents encompass a range of standardized templates and petitions required by the San Diego County Superior Court to formally commence, respond to, and finalize divorce proceedings. Examples include the Petition for Dissolution, Summons, Response, and various financial disclosure forms.

The proper completion and filing of these mandated papers is crucial for ensuring a legally sound divorce settlement. Adherence to court requirements avoids delays and potential dismissal of the case. Historically, individuals navigated this process without digital resources; presently, while some forms are accessible online, understanding their specific requirements often necessitates legal counsel to safeguard individual rights and ensure compliance.

A legally recognized document issued by the Superior Court of California, County of San Diego, serves as official confirmation that a marriage dissolution has been finalized within that jurisdiction. This document typically includes the names of the parties involved, the case number, and the date the divorce was granted. Its purpose is to provide conclusive proof of the terminated marital status. For example, a woman who has resumed her maiden name after a divorce in San Diego may require this certificate to update her driver’s license or social security record.

The importance of possessing this legal record stems from its utility in various legal and administrative processes. It allows individuals to remarry, claim single status for tax purposes, and update beneficiaries on insurance policies and retirement accounts. Historically, such documentation has played a crucial role in establishing legal identity and marital status, impacting inheritance, property rights, and societal norms. The existence of readily accessible and verifiable records protects individuals from potential challenges to their marital status and related rights.

The financial implications of dissolving a marriage in the specified Southern California locale encompass a range of expenses. These expenses typically include attorney fees, court filing fees, the cost of expert witnesses (such as appraisers or forensic accountants), and potentially mediation or collaborative divorce fees. For example, a simple, uncontested dissolution with minimal assets may incur lower costs than a complex case involving significant property division, child custody disputes, or spousal support considerations.

Understanding the financial burden associated with marital dissolution is crucial for individuals contemplating or undergoing this process. Planning and budgeting for these expenses can mitigate financial strain and facilitate a smoother legal proceeding. Historically, legal representation has been a primary driver of the total expenditure, highlighting the value of exploring alternative dispute resolution methods and carefully selecting legal counsel.

Legal professionals specializing in dissolution of marriage cases involving members of the armed forces stationed in or near a major Southern California metropolitan area provide services tailored to the unique challenges inherent in such proceedings. These challenges often include jurisdictional complexities due to frequent relocations, division of military retirement benefits, and adherence to federal laws like the Uniformed Services Former Spouses’ Protection Act (USFSPA).

Engaging experienced counsel is vital given the intricate legal and financial considerations at play. Such representation can assist in navigating the specific procedures for serving legal documents on active-duty personnel, understanding the impact of deployment on court schedules, and accurately valuing and dividing military pensions, which are subject to specific formulas and regulations. Furthermore, these attorneys possess familiarity with military culture and the potential impact of the divorce on a service member’s career.

A dissolution of marriage involving a service member stationed in or residing near the Southern California city represents a specific intersection of family law and military regulations. This legal process, typically handled in civilian courts, requires careful consideration of federal laws impacting retirement benefits, healthcare, and child custody arrangements when one or both spouses are affiliated with the armed forces and have ties to that metropolitan area. For example, the division of military pension under the Uniformed Services Former Spouses Protection Act (USFSPA) adds complexity to property division during proceedings involving individuals connected to local naval bases or Marine Corps installations.

The significance of understanding the nuanced requirements stems from the unique circumstances often faced by military families. Frequent relocations, deployments, and the specific rules governing military pay and benefits all contribute to the need for specialized legal guidance. Historically, access to knowledgeable representation has proven vital in ensuring equitable outcomes for both service members and their spouses when navigating the dissolution process in this locale. The benefits of proper legal counsel are manifest in securing fair settlements, protecting parental rights, and managing the long-term financial implications of the divorce.
